在IDEA中高效使用GitHub的完整指南

目录

引言

在现代软件开发中,GitHub是一个不可或缺的工具,而*IDEA(IntelliJ IDEA)*作为一款强大的集成开发环境,为开发者提供了便利的GitHub集成功能。本文将详细介绍如何在IDEA中使用GitHub,以提升项目的协作效率和代码管理能力。

IDEA与GitHub的集成

在使用IDEA之前,了解它与GitHub的集成是非常重要的。IDEA内置了对Git的支持,能够帮助用户轻松地与GitHub进行交互。通过IDEA,开发者可以直接在IDE内进行版本控制,而无需使用命令行。

集成的优势

  • 直观的图形界面,简化操作
  • 提高协作效率
  • 方便地管理多个分支

如何配置GitHub账户

在IDEA中使用GitHub之前,首先需要配置GitHub账户。下面是具体步骤:

  1. 打开IDEA,点击File -> Settings
  2. 在设置窗口中,选择Version Control -> GitHub
  3. 点击Add Account,输入你的GitHub账户信息(如用户名和密码)或使用OAuth授权。
  4. 点击Test按钮确认连接成功。

通过以上步骤,你就完成了GitHub账户的配置。

克隆GitHub项目

克隆现有的GitHub项目到IDEA是使用GitHub的基本操作之一。操作步骤如下:

  1. 在GitHub上找到想要克隆的项目,复制其HTTPS或SSH链接。
  2. 在IDEA中,选择File -> New -> Project from Version Control -> Git
  3. 粘贴复制的项目链接,并选择存储路径。
  4. 点击Clone,IDEA会自动下载该项目。

克隆后注意事项

  • 确保选择正确的分支
  • 确认所有依赖项已经安装

创建新的GitHub项目

如果你想在GitHub上创建一个新的项目,可以通过以下步骤在IDEA中进行:

  1. 打开IDEA,点击File -> New Project
  2. 选择项目类型,点击Next,填写项目信息。
  3. 完成后,点击Finish创建项目。
  4. 在项目创建完成后,右击项目根目录,选择Git -> Repository -> Share Project on GitHub
  5. 按照提示登录并填写项目信息,点击Share

提交与推送更改

在开发过程中,定期提交和推送更改是维护代码版本的重要环节。操作步骤如下:

  1. 在IDEA中进行代码修改。
  2. 右击文件或项目,选择Git -> Add以添加更改。
  3. 然后选择Git -> Commit,填写提交信息,点击Commit
  4. 最后选择Git -> Push将更改推送到远程仓库。

拉取请求和分支管理

在团队协作中,分支管理和拉取请求(Pull Request)至关重要。使用IDEA,你可以轻松管理这些操作:

创建分支

  • 在IDEA中选择Git -> Branches -> New Branch,输入新分支名称并点击Create

提交拉取请求

  • 在IDEA中提交后,在GitHub上打开项目页面,选择Pull Requests,然后点击New Pull Request,选择要合并的分支。

处理合并冲突

在多人协作时,合并冲突是常见问题。处理步骤如下:

  1. 在IDEA中,选择Git -> Pull,如果有冲突会提示。
  2. 找到冲突文件,IDEA会标记出冲突部分。
  3. 手动解决冲突后,右击文件选择Mark as Resolved
  4. 提交更改,完成合并。

常见问题解答

1. 如何在IDEA中配置SSH密钥?

在IDEA中配置SSH密钥,首先在GitHub中生成SSH密钥,然后在IDEA的设置中配置SSH路径。

2. IDEA如何显示Git版本信息?

可以通过在IDEA中选择VCS -> Git -> Show Git Log来查看版本信息。

3. 如何同步远程分支?

选择Git -> Fetch可以同步远程分支,确保你的本地仓库是最新的。

4. IDEA如何处理子模块?

在IDEA中通过选择Git -> Submodule可以轻松管理Git子模块。

5. 在IDEA中如何撤销最近的提交?

选择VCS -> Git -> Reset HEAD,选择适当的选项进行撤销。

结语

通过以上方法和技巧,你可以在IDEA中高效使用GitHub,优化你的项目管理和协作流程。希望本文能对你的开发工作有所帮助。

正文完